Overview
About a year since her father suddenly died of a heart attack, Minnie Logan takes over her family business as the sole owner of Logan's Coffee Shop, a staple in a small New England town. Struggling to keep up her grandfather's legacy and rent payments, Minnie has less than a month to creatively preserve and renew her company.
Robert Vaughan, the CFO, of a giant coffee conglomerate arrives in the small town to gather any information he can about the struggling shop in pursuit of a potential takeover in thirty days. Unbeknownst to Minnie, she falls in love Robert under false pretenses while she uses the magic of love to give back to the community that has given so much to her.

About the Author
Kathryn Starke is an urban literacy consultant, reading specialist, adjunct professor, and former elementary school teacher. She is the founder of Creative Minds Publications, an educational publishing company and The Starke School. Starke is the author of Amy's Travels, Tackle Reading, and A Touchdown in Reading: An Educator’s Guide to Literacy Instruction. After she wrote her first women’s fiction novel, Because of You, in 2012 she was selected as one of the 50 writers you should be reading. Starke graduated from Longwood University with a BS and elementary education and a MS in Literacy and Culture.
